Fix bug in pthread_sigmask() semantics.
[akaros.git] / tests / bind.c
index 564cf80..5467934 100644 (file)
@@ -4,7 +4,7 @@
 #include <sys/types.h>
 #include <sys/stat.h>
 #include <fcntl.h>
-#include <arch/arch.h>
+#include <parlib/arch/arch.h>
 #include <unistd.h>
 #include <errno.h>
 #include <dirent.h>
@@ -47,5 +47,7 @@ int main(int argc, char *argv[])
        printf("bind %s -> %s flag %d\n", src_path, onto_path, flag);
        ret = syscall(SYS_nbind, src_path, strlen(src_path), onto_path,
                      strlen(onto_path), flag);
+       if (ret < 0)
+               perror("Bind failed");
        return ret;
 }